Lacroix, officially known as Lacroix Group, is a prominent player in the electronics and industrial sectors, headquartered in France. Established in 1936, the company has evolved significantly, marking key milestones in the development of electronic solutions and services. With a strong presence in Europe and expanding operations globally, Lacroix focuses on smart industrial solutions, embedded systems, and connected devices. The company is renowned for its innovative products, including electronic boards and systems that cater to various industries such as automotive, telecommunications, and energy. Lacroix's commitment to quality and technological advancement has solidified its market position, making it a trusted partner for businesses seeking cutting-edge electronic solutions. With a rich history and a forward-thinking approach, Lacroix continues to drive progress in the electronics industry.

Lacroix's reported carbon emissions

In 2024, Lacroix reported total carbon emissions of approximately 2,775,544,000 kg CO2e, with emissions distributed across various scopes: 1,669,000 kg CO2e (Scope 1), 9,782,000 kg CO2e (Scope 2), and 9,371,000 kg CO2e (Scope 3). This data reflects a comprehensive approach to emissions reporting, including all three scopes. For the previous year, 2023, Lacroix's emissions were significantly higher, totalling approximately 1,163,000,000 kg CO2e across all scopes, with Scope 1 at 81,320,000 kg CO2e, Scope 2 at 81,782,000 kg CO2e, and Scope 3 at 1,153,575,000 kg CO2e. This indicates a potential shift in emissions management strategies. Lacroix has set ambitious reduction targets, aiming for a 54.6% reduction in absolute Scope 1 and 2 emissions by 2033, using 2023 as the baseline year. Additionally, they are targeting a 61.1% reduction in Scope 3 emissions per EUR value added within the same timeframe. These targets are aligned with the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i) and are designed to support global efforts to limit temperature rise to 1.5°C. The company has also achieved a notable reduction of 42% in Scope 1 and 2 emissions from 2021 levels, decreasing from 14,900 kg CO2e to 13,500 kg CO2e by 2025. This commitment to reducing greenhouse gas emissions demonstrates Lacroix's proactive stance in addressing climate change and its impact on the environment. Lacroix's emissions data is cascaded from its parent company, LACROIX Group SA, ensuring consistency and transparency in their climate commitments.
